Social media platform Instagram is one of the most popular places on the web to post photographs, and now they have revealed a list of the 10 most photographed spots in the world.

According to an article on the Daily Express, Times Square in New York was the most instagrammed spot in the world in 2015, followed by the Eiffel Tower and London’s Tower Bridge.

In fourth place was Moscow’s Red Square. The Dodger Stadium in Los Angeles and Istanbul’s famous Istiklal Caddesi avenue came in fifth and sixth respectively. Sao Paolo in Brazil came seventh in the list, Amsterdam’s beautiful Vondelpark was eighth, Barcelona’s Park Güell was ninth and San Francisco’s Golden Gate Bridge rounded off the top 10.
